Review Questions for the Midterm
Questions 1-10 classify the following variables as:
a. Nominal
b. Ordinal
c. Ratio
d. Interval
1. _____ Number of goals scored by a team during a season
2. _____ Number of audit units Winter quarter students register for
3. _____ Blood type of white males at LLUMC
4. _____ Stages of cancer
5. _____ Zip codes
6. _____ Region of the country (1= East, 2= South, 3= Midwest, 4= West)
7. _____ Social security numbers
8. _____ Final letter grades given in data analysis & management class
9. _____ Ability of children to reach over their head with their right hand and touch the top of their left ear
10. _____ Commuting times to work
Questions 11-14 compute the following
ID Waiting time at a bank (in minutes)
1 10
2 17
3 8
4 15
5 12
6 13
7 14
8 16
9 35
10 18
11 35
11. Find the (a) mean, (b) median, (c) mode for the waiting time variable?
12. Find the (a) variance, (b) standard deviation, (c) range, interquartile range for the waiting time variable?
13. Is there any extreme outliers? If yes, how many?
14. What the best measure of central tendency to summarize the waiting time?

Questions 18-22 In 6 trials of flipping a coin, assuming the chance of getting a tail is 30 %, what is the probability of:
19. Getting 4 tails?
20. Getting less than 3 tails?
21. Getting 4 or less tails?
22. Getting 3 or more tails?
23. Getting more than 4 tails?
Questions 24-25: Using the standard normal distribution table, find the following:
24. The area under the standard normal curve above Z of 1.54?
25. The area under the standard normal curve between a Z of -1.90 and + 1.90?
